About R. Hauck

R. Hauck is a scholar working on Media Technology, Atomic and Molecular Physics, and Optics and Computer Graphics and Computer-Aided Design, having authored 32 papers that have together received 371 indexed citations. Recurring topics across this work include Advanced Optical Imaging Technologies (12 papers), Photorefractive and Nonlinear Optics (8 papers) and Digital Holography and Microscopy (8 papers). The work is most often cited by research in Media Technology (161 citations), Atomic and Molecular Physics, and Optics (243 citations) and Computer Vision and Pattern Recognition (91 citations). R. Hauck has collaborated with scholars based in Germany and United States. Frequent co-authors include Olof Bryngdahl, H. Weber, Reiner Eschbach, Adolf W. Lohmann, Frank Wyrowski, N. Hodgson, Dieter Just, Willard Thorp, William T. Rhodes and Jerome Klinkowitz. Their work appears in journals such as Journal of Applied Physics, Journal of the Optical Society of America A and Optics Communications.
